First, wet your face with warm water (don’t dry the face, leave it dripping wet). Then place 3-4 drops of the oil into the palm of your hand and gently massage into the bristles of your wet face until completely absorbed (around 30-60 seconds).
Leave the pre shave oil on and apply a quality shaving cream like the Alexander Simpson Ultra-Glide cream. Start shaving as usual and finishing an epic shave by applying Simpson soothing & moisturising post shave balm.
Unlike some Shaving Oils that can be applied to dry skin, this Pre-Shave Oil works best by increasing the skin suppleness and pliability NOT by providing lubrication, well-moisturized and supple skin does not cut or become irritated as easily as dry skin.

From the manufacturer of Simpsons shaving brushes comes a new range of quality pre-shave oils designed to deliver outstanding performance. Alexander Simpson Est. 1919 embodies all the values of this great company: heritage, quality and tradition.
Scotsman Alexander Simpson started production of shaving brushes and male grooming ancillaries in 1919 and is widely regarded as a pioneer in the industry. Manufacturing was originally based in the East end of London but later in Clapham. In 1941, following the loss of his factory during the World War II German Luftwaffe blitz, production was moved to the West Country at the famous Nimmer Mill. Today Simpson shaving brushes and associated products are manufactured by Progress Shaving Brush (Vulfix) Limited on the historic Isle of Man. They continue to be produced in the traditional way using hand tied knots by time served, skilled workers.
